Case - IH CVX
Coolant capacity & service interval
Case IH CVX coolant capacity is 25 liters. Service intervals include checking every 10 hours and changing every 1000 hours or 12 months. The data covers 15 configurations.

Additional Notes
- The Case-IH CVX cooling system capacity is 25 liters across all listed models, spanning the CVX 120 through CVX1195. A 25-liter figure for a cooling system of this class reflects the total system volume including the engine block, cylinder head passages, radiator, and associated hoses rather than a partial service top-up quantity.
- The standard coolant change interval across all CVX variants is 1000 hours or 12 months under normal use conditions, whichever comes first. The dual-trigger format means a tractor used lightly in a calendar year still reaches the time-based threshold before accumulating 1000 operating hours.
- The CVX1135, CVX1145, CVX1155, CVX1170, CVX1190, and CVX1195 models from the 2003-2007 period carry an additional 10-hour coolant check interval not present in the other CVX variants. A 10-hour check interval is a very short cycle, typically associated with early operating hours after a fluid change or during initial break-in, used to verify level stability and detect early leaks.
- The CVX 120, CVX 130, CVX 150, and CVX 170 models are listed for the 2001-2003 period, while the CVX 140, CVX 150, CVX 160, CVX 175, and CVX 195 appear in the 2007-2013 period. The CVX 150 designation spans both generation ranges, each sharing the same 25-liter capacity and 1000-hour or 12-month change interval.
- The four-digit CVX1xxx series covers the 2003-2007 period and shares the same 25-liter capacity and 1000-hour or 12-month change interval as the three-digit CVX models. The numbering convention differs between the two series, but the cooling system specifications remain consistent across both.
